A new book produced by The Riley Institute at Furman University and W. Robert Saffold gets a ringing endorsement from Andy Brack, editor and publisher of Statehouse Report. “A People’s Movement” tells the story of how Furman alumnus and former Gov. Richard W. Riley and a coalition of state and local leaders pushed through a penny tax for educational improvement during his second term in the 1980s.

Brack highlights many of the “plays” Riley employed to help move South Carolina out of generational underachievement in public education – strategies that can be applied to any legislative initiative.
